Q: Is 2,552,182 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 2,552,182 is not a prime number.

Why is 2,552,182 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 2552182 can be evenly divided by 1 2 179 358 7,129 14,258 1,276,091 and 2,552,182, with no remainder.

Since 2,552,182 cannot be divided by just 1 and 2,552,182, it is not a prime number.
